A Group of Asylum Seekers Walked a Memorial March for Lisa on Wednesday Evening. The Group Resides in the Reception Location in Amsterdam Where the Suspect in Lisa’s Death also Stayed. 20 to 25 Asylum Seekers Participated in the March, a Coa Spokesperson Tells Nu.nl.
The Group, Including Young Women, Walked with White Carnations from Metro Station Strandvliet to the Place Where Lisa was Found Dead Last Week, Reports The NOS .
The Asylum Seekers Left a Blue Heart As A Memorial at the Discovery Site. It Reads: “Our Hearts Are With You Lisa. Residents of Coa Hogehilweg”. The Heart Can Be Seen In The Photo Below.
The Commemoration was organized by Sawa Collective, An Organization That Works for Asylum Seekers. The Central Agency for the Reception of Asylum Seekers (COA) Works Closely With Them, The Spokesperson Said. “Residents at Other Coa Locations also show a lot of Involvement. They want to mean something.”
The Lisa Case Has Griped the Netherlands this Past Week. A Crowdfunding Campaign Under The Name ‘We Demand the Night’ Raised More Than Half A Million Euros. On the night of Tuesday to Wednesday, facades in Amsterdam Turned Orange to Draw Attention to Violence Against Women.
The 22-year-old suspect is An Asylum Seeker and was arrested on Thursday Evening at the Coa Location in Amsterdam, a short for minutes from the place where lisa was killed. The Amsterdam Court Decided on Monday that he will Remain in Custody for Two More Weeks.
